Какво е ERC-1155 и как работи?
Начало
Статии
Какво е ERC-1155 и как работи?

Какво е ERC-1155 и как работи?

Напреднал
Публикувано Jan 30, 2024Актуализирано Apr 18, 2024
6m

Резюме

  • ERC-1155 е стандарт за токени за Ethereum, предназначен да оптимизира създаването и управлението на криптоактиви.

  • Той позволява комбинацията от заменими и незаменими токени в един смарт договор, рационализирайки трансакциите и намалявайки разходите.

  • Сигурният механизъм за трансфер на ERC-1155 и други функции за безопасност повишават доверието на потребителите и се справят с често срещаните предизвикателства, свързани с изпращането на токени на неправилни адреси.

Въведение

Ethereum, блокчейнът, който запозна света със смарт договори и децентрализирани приложения (DApp), продължава да се развива бързо. Сред забележителните му характеристики са така наречените стандарти за токени, които гарантират, че активите и продуктите, изградени на Ethereum, са съвместими един с друг. 

Заедно с ERC-20 и ERC-721, ERC-1155 е един от най-важните стандарти за токени в Ethereum. В това задълбочено проучване ще вникнем в тънкостите на ERC-1155, ще разберем как работи и неговото значение в блокчейн екосистемата.

Какво представлява стандартът за токени на ERC-1155?

ERC-1155, съкращение от Ethereum Request for Comments 1155, представлява набор от стандарти, предназначени да подобрят гъвкавостта на смарт договорите и токените в блокчейна на Ethereum. В контекста на блокчейн токените са цифрови активи, които могат да бъдат заменими (идентични и взаимозаменяеми) или незаменими (всеки токен е уникален). Преди ERC-1155 тези два вида токени се управляваха от различни технически стандарти, като ERC-20 за заменими токени и ERC-721 за незаменими токени (NFT).

Как работи ERC-1155

За да разберем значението на ERC-1155, нека си представим сценарий, в който взаимодействате с блокчейн игра, която има разнообразен набор от предмети като мечове, щитове и монети в играта. Преди ERC-1155 всеки от тези елементи изискваше изключителен набор от правила в рамките на смарт договор. ERC-1155 опростява тази сложност, като позволява на всички тези разнообразни елементи да съществуват хармонично в рамките на един смарт договор. Така че, вместо да управлява отделни договори за всеки дигитален артикул, ERC-1155 ги консолидира, рационализирайки управлението на различни токени.

Основни предимства на ERC-1155

Накратко, ERC-1155 се откроява със своята ефективност, адаптивност, намаляване на излишъка, подобрени функции за сигурност и поддръжка на различни типове токени.

1. Повишена ефективност

С ERC-1155 прехвърлянето на различни типове токени може да се случи в една трансакция. Тази способност значително ускорява трансакциите и намалява свързаните разходи. Представете си, че изпращате меч, щит и малко златни монети на приятел – всичко това се извършва безпроблемно в една трансакция.

2. Универсалност отвъд игрите

Въпреки че ERC-1155 е много полезен за приложения с игри, неговата адаптивност се простира далеч отвъд тази ниша. Той може без усилие да обработва всеки тип токен, независимо дали е валута, колекционерски предмети или специализирани билети. Тази гъвкавост позиционира ERC-1155 като ценен инструмент за разнообразни приложения в различни индустрии.

3. Намаляване на съкращенията

Преди ERC-1155 всеки тип токен изискваше собствен договор, което доведе до излишни копия на подобни функционалности. ERC-1155 облекчава този излишък чрез консолидиране на различни типове токени в рамките на един договор, оптимизиране на използването на пространството и опростяване на управлението на токени.

4. Безопасен механизъм за прехвърляне

ERC-1155 включва функция за безопасност, която позволява възстановяването на токени, ако по невнимание бъдат изпратени на грешен адрес. Това представлява значително подобрение спрямо предишните стандарти за токени, предоставяйки на потребителите подобрена сигурност и спокойствие.

5. Поддръжка за различни видове токени

За разлика от своите предшественици, ERC-1155 поддържа не само заменими и незаменими токени, но и полузаменяеми токени. Тези токени, подобни на билетите за концерт с общ вход, са взаимозаменяеми преди показването, но след това се трансформират в уникални колекционерски предмети.

ERC-20 срещу ERC-1155 срещу ERC-721

По-долу е дадена кратка сравнителна таблица, подчертаваща ключовите разлики между стандартите за токени ERC-20, ERC-1155 и ERC-721.

Както можем да видим, ERC-20 се използва за взаимозаменяеми токени като дигитална валута, ERC-721 е за уникални токени като дигитално изкуство, а ERC-1155 комбинира функции, предлагайки гъвкавост и за двата случая на използване в рамките на един договор.

Кой използва ERC-1155?

Много проекти използват предимствата, предлагани от ERC-1155. Някои забележителни примери включват:

  • Enjin: блокчейн платформа, която използва ERC-1155 за захранване на своите цифрови активи и екосистема на виртуални икономики. Enjin е фокусирана върху създаването на NFT и Web3 активи, използвани в базирани на блокчейн игри.

  • OpenSea: Известен пазар за NFT, използващ ERC-1155, позволяващ множество създатели на договор, като по този начин насърчава сътрудничеството и творчеството.

  • OpenZeppelin: Доставчик на продукти за сигурност на блокчейн, използващ стандарта ERC-1155, подчертавайки приемането му в критични области на блокчейн екосистемата.

Бъдещият пейзаж на ERC-1155

Въпреки че съществува от няколко години, ERC-1155 продължава да бъде недостатъчно използван в сравнение със своите аналози на ERC-20 и ERC-721. Това може да произтича от липсата на осведоменост за неговите възможности, но тъй като проектите стават по-запознати с гъвкавостта на ERC-1155, миграцията към този стандарт може да се превърне в естествена прогресия.

Появата на игри от типа „играй, за да спечелиш“, където играчите могат да печелят токени, докато играят, може да помогне за ускоряване на приемането на ERC-1155. В допълнение, децентрализираните автономни организации (DAO) също намират полза в ERC-1155, особено тези, които работят предимно в блокчейн и изискват различни видове токени.

Гъвкавостта, присъща на ERC-1155, отваря вратата към различни случаи на употреба, много от които все още не са напълно проучени. С напредването на блокчейн технологията ERC-1155 е готов да играе централна роля в оформянето на бъдещето на дигиталните активи в мрежата на Ethereum.

Предимства на ERC-1155

  • Трансакции, удобни за потребителя: С ефективността на ERC-1155 потребителите могат да очакват по-плавни и по-рентабилни трансакции, особено когато работят с множество видове токени.

  • Разширена функционалност за DAO: Децентрализираните автономни организации (DAO) могат да се възползват от поддръжката на ERC-1155 за различни видове токени, улеснявайки операциите в блокчейна.

  • Играй, за да спечелиш: Появата на игри от типа „играй, за да спечелиш“ може да стимулира приемането на ERC-1155, предлагайки на играчите възможността да печелят токени безпроблемно по време на игра.

Докато проектите изследват и интегрират ERC-1155, потенциалните ползи за потребителите, разработчиците и по-широката блокчейн общност стават все по-очевидни.

Заключителни мисли

В обобщение, ERC-1155 донесе големи подобрения в екосистемата на Ethereum, като рационализира управлението на токени, намалява съкращаването и отключва нови възможности. Неговото въздействие вече е очевидно в различни проекти и с увеличаването на осведомеността, ERC-1155 вероятно ще продължи да функционира като крайъгълен камък на стандартите за токени на Ethereum.

Допълнителни статии

Отказ от отговорност и предупреждение за риск: Това съдържание ви се представя на база „както е“ само за обща информация и образователни цели, без твърдения или гаранция от какъвто и да е вид. Не трябва да се тълкува като финансов, правен или друг професионален съвет, нито има за цел да препоръча покупката на конкретен продукт или услуга. Трябва да потърсите собствен съвет от подходящи професионални съветници. Когато статията е предоставена от сътрудник трета страна, имайте предвид, че тези изразени мнения принадлежат на сътрудника трета страна и не отразяват непременно тези на Binance Academy. Моля, прочетете нашия пълен отказ от отговорност тук за повече подробности. Цените на цифровите активи могат да бъдат нестабилни. Стойността на вашата инвестиция може да намалее или да се повиши и може да не си върнете инвестираната сума. Вие носите цялата отговорност за вашите инвестиционни решения и Binance Academy не носи отговорност за каквито и да било загуби, които може да понесете. Този материал не трябва да се тълкува като финансов, правен или друг професионален съвет. За повече информация вижте нашите Условия за ползване и Предупреждението за риск.